The Royal Couple’s Year of Changes

Kate Middleton and Prince William constantly think of Queen Elizabeth. According to royal author Sally Bedell Smith, the couple “are maintaining a good balance between fulfilling their duties and educating their children as privately as possible,” although the thought of the sovereign who passed away on September 8, 2022 is always strong and burning, especially on the first anniversary of her death. For Kate Middleton and William, this has been a year of constant changes.

Paying Homage to the Queen

Not only because they are now direct heirs of Charles, but also because they try, in one way or another, to pay homage to the queen in the most respectful and delicate way possible, carrying on her style and teachings. “The prince was incredibly close to his grandmother,” says a source close to the family to People. “She was a very important part of his life and a true supporter of his work, and I’m sure he and the princess miss her presence a lot.” In the last 12 months, the Prince and Princess of Wales have carried out a work that will be central in their lives for decades to come: Kate Middleton has, in fact, approved an initiative for early childhood thanks to Shaping Us, while William is focusing on a new project for the homeless entitled Homewards and is strengthening his institutional role, meeting, among others, President Joe Biden in Boston.

Family Life and Relations with Prince Harry and Meghan Markle

In addition to royal duties, William and Kate Middleton’s family life has also undergone a huge change. The first day at Lambrook School for Prince George, 10, Princess Charlotte, 8, and Prince Louis, 5, was, in fact, the day of the Queen’s death. Since then, the children have been more visible than ever, participating in important family and formal events while Charles has bestowed William and Kate with the titles of Prince and Princess of Wales, titles previously held by the same Charles and his first wife, Princess Diana. “Charles is paving the way for them, and both are involved in the decision-making process behind the scenes. They are ready and willing to do their work,” a friend of the princess tells People, but always confirming the attachment to the queen, “who has played a very important role in all their lives.” Meanwhile, relations with Prince Harry and Meghan Markle remain cold and distant. When talk of Harry’s return to London to attend the WellChild charity awards before moving to Germany for the Invictus Games was in the air, many hoped for a reunion with his brother and father, but unfortunately it did not happen.
